I'm running a stock 5.0 with a Kenne Bellat6 psi and 19 lb/hr injectors with an FMU. Runs just fine.If you keep your boost at 6-8 psi, you don't need a custom tune, larger MAF, larger fuel pump or any of that jazz.
I've been running this combo for 8 years with no issues. No blown head gaskets, no burnt pistons, no probs.

Just wondering, if I take that 3600 for the kb and run a different direction and do something like the trick flow top end with exaust, maybe an underdrive pully and some lower gears, how would that compare to 8-10psi from a kb on a stock motor?

with that money if u want to stay naturally aspired..u can piece together a kit that gets more power per dollar spent than by going with trickflows kit...im not saying its a bad kit..ive ridden in a 95 with the stage 1 kit many times..my friends..and its definatly fast...but u can do better for 3600 u can almost buy an entire motor minus intake from fordstrokers and have a sweet package

Similar gains, a guy with an 11psi KB on a stock 5.0 made just over 300whp, huge torque though. That was with the 1.5 kit. Putting together a good h/c/i you should be at a similiar point.

Either way I would still need to get the bigger injectors/fuel pump/tune/whatever though right? With a lower gear, would the car still feel like it had all that lovely torque? What H/C/I combo would be better for the money, how much would it hurt to keep the stock cam?

if ur heads are off already might as well put in a better cam....the stock isnt worthless....but theres much better outta aftermarket..if u go that route give ur head details as well as intake n get a custom cam ground thats the best way to go..off the shelf cams arent bad either if u want to save some money but custom is always better..as for fuel..my buddies 95 with tfs1 kit has 24lb injectors..stock pump, and hasnt been tuned yet n it runs fine...sure theres more in it with a tune but it runs good now too
